44 minutes ago, pskys2 said:

But it also adds a lot of weight & at an awkward position.  I played with a buddy's, didn't shoot though, & didn't see a difference.  Buddy has since gone to an Allchin I believe.

 

Now for a traditional C-more I think it does make a difference.

It’s 3oz heavier than the allchin/rts2 combo. 
 

What the 90 degree mount does better than everything else is index better, especially with one hand. The advantage of being able to see the barrel and or  front sight is huge.
